Albany, NY -- (SBWire) -- 02/14/2018 --Robot operating system is middleware, a collection of software framework and toolset upon which robotics system can be developed or constructed. It is a collection of software libraries and tools used by roboticists to develop various application. ROS uses OS's process management system, file system, user interface and programming utilities. The most used operating system is Linux followed by MAC OS X and now even windows are compatible for this platform. Depending upon application, the global robot operating system market can be broadly divided into commercial and industrial. The commercial segment can be further divided into healthcare, hospitality, retail, agriculture, farming, etc. Similarly, the industrial segment can be further divided into automotive, electronics, information technology, food and packaging, rubber and plastics, logistics and warehousing, etc. Among them, the sub-segment of healthcare is predicted to expand at a healthy clip due to the thirst of the sector for cutting-edge technologies.
North America, at present, holds a dominant position in the global robot operating system market, driven primarily by the commercial sector. Other factors benefitting the market is the demand for better services by consumers, swift uptake of latest technology in the region, and development of more advanced versions of ROS platforms. By rising at a CAGR of 7.7%, the market in the region is expected to grow its dominant share in revenue to US$166.2 mn by 2025 from US$87.5 mn in 2016.
Europe trails North America in the global robot operating system market in terms of revenue generation. Nations of Germany, France, and the U.K. are at the forefront of driving growth in the region. The region is likely to expand at a solid 8.0% CAGR from 2017 to 2025. Vis-à-vis growth rate, Asia Pacific is expected to outshine all other regions by registering a CAGR of 9.2% over the course of the forecast period. India and China are main markets in the region on account of the increased pace of industrialization. South Korea and Taiwan are other key markets in the region in terms of generating demand. One factor posing a challenge to the market, on the other hand, is the security issues in the design implementation of robot operating system. To tide over the problem, many suppliers of robotics operating systems provide ROS that is protected, secured, and then commercialized. This has enabled their use in sensitive areas such as aerospace, defense, and marine.
